Output 38aaf9c31bcfca229e39f9c4cc81393e19bc906c15dedca268aff6daaca6f28d:1

value
1454184536
script pubkey
OP_0 OP_PUSHBYTES_20 337907239d66a360c964e0b5e01f758d0eaec876
address
bc1qxduswguav63kpjtyuz67q8m43582ajrkc4x8ze
transaction
38aaf9c31bcfca229e39f9c4cc81393e19bc906c15dedca268aff6daaca6f28d
spent
true